What is a sheet cake?


A sheet cake is a type of cake that is baked in a large, shallow rectangular or square pan called a sheet pan. It is typically single-layered. Sheet cakes are perfect for feeding a large crowd.

They are popular for their simplicity and ease of preparation, as well as their versatility in terms of flavor and decoration. Sheet cakes can be cut into squares or rectangles and are commonly frosted or decorated with various toppings, such as buttercream frosting, whipped cream, or glaze.


Ingredients:


For the cake:


  • 1 – 15.25 oz box yellow cake mix
  • 1 cup water
  • ½ cup vegetable oil
  • 3 large eggs

For the Raspberry Glaze and frosting:


  • 2 Tablespoons Cornstarch
  • ½ cup Sugar
  • 6 ounce container Fresh Raspberries
  • 1 Tablespoon Lemon Juice
  • 8 oz container whipped topping

Directions:


Preheat the oven to 350 degrees. Grease a 9×13 inch baking pan.

For a sheet cake, use a large rectangular baking pan with high sides.

Bring your eggs to room temperature before starting the recipe. This helps create a smoother batter and ensures even baking.

Add the cake mix, water, oil, and eggs to a large mixing bowl, and beat on high speed for 3 minutes.

Mix the cake batter just until the ingredients are incorporated, being careful not to overwork it.

Pour batter into the prepared pan, and bake for 28-30 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center of the cake comes out clean.

Remove the cake from the oven. Allow the cake to cool in the cake pan for a few minutes, then transfer it to a wire rack to cool completely.

To make the raspberry glaze, mix the cornstarch and sugar together in a small bowl with a whisk.

Add the raspberries and lemon juice to a small saucepan, and add the cornstarch and sugar mixture, then stir well.

Cook over medium heat for 15 minutes, stirring often, while chopping the berries with the spatula.

Once the mixture is done, refrigerate for 2 hours.

Once the cake and glaze has cooled, spread the mixture over the entire surface of the cake.

Top with whipped topping.

How to Frost a Sheet Cake


  • Make sure the cake has cooled completely before frosting to prevent the frosting from melting or sliding off.
  • Add a generous amount of frosting to the top of the cake and spread it evenly using the spatula. Start from the center and work your way towards the edges, smoothing the frosting as you go.
  • Allow the frosted cake to set before serving or storing the cake.

Easy Yellow Sheet Cake FAQ’s


How long to bake a 9×13 yellow sheet cake?


The bake time for a 9×13 yellow sheet cake can vary depending on the recipe and the specific oven. However, as a general guideline, you can expect a 9×13 sheet cake to bake for approximately 25 to 35 minutes at a temperature of 350°F.



It’s always recommended to start checking for doneness around the 25-minute mark and continue baking until a toothpick inserted into the center of the cake comes out clean or with a few moist crumbs.


Is a sheet cake the same as a regular cake?


A sheet cake is a type of cake that is baked in a large, shallow pan, typically a rectangular or square shape. It is different from a regular cake, which is typically baked in round or layered pans. The main difference is in the shape and size of the cake.



Sheet cake recipes are usually single-layer cakes that can be easily cut into squares or rectangles for serving. Regular cakes, on the other hand, are more commonly seen as round or layered cakes.


How many layers should a sheet cake be?


A sheet cake is typically a single-layer cake, meaning it is baked in a shallow pan and does not have multiple cake layers like a traditional layered cake.

How many cake mixes for a sheet cake?


The number of cake mixes needed for a sheet cake depends on the size of the sheet cake you want to bake. Typically, a standard cake mix is meant to make one 9×13-inch rectangular cake.
